Foros del Web » Programación para mayores de 30 ;) » Java »

JSP mensajes de alerta

Estas en el tema de JSP mensajes de alerta en el foro de Java en Foros del Web. Buenas tardes muchachos, tengo un problema ni el mas tenas, resulta que mi aplicación en jsp, le aplique la librería swing, la cual deja sacar ...
  #1 (permalink)  
Antiguo 21/09/2010, 15:53
Avatar de cesarazapata  
Fecha de Ingreso: mayo-2010
Ubicación: Bogota
Mensajes: 12
Antigüedad: 13 años, 11 meses
Puntos: 0
Exclamación JSP mensajes de alerta

Buenas tardes muchachos,
tengo un problema ni el mas tenas, resulta que mi aplicación en jsp, le aplique la librería swing, la cual deja sacar los mensajes de JOPtionPane, resulta pasa y acontece de que esta librería solo sirve para aplicaciones de escritorio y no para aplicaciones web, ya que en contenedor de java se encuentra en el servidor, entonces cada vez que generaba un alerta me aparece en el maquina servido y no en la del cliente, mi pregunta es como hago para hacer estos mensajes, ya probe con java script y no me sirve como se plantea, de antemano muchas gracias por su colaboración

Última edición por cesarazapata; 21/09/2010 a las 15:59
  #2 (permalink)  
Antiguo 21/09/2010, 17:45
 
Fecha de Ingreso: agosto-2010
Mensajes: 126
Antigüedad: 13 años, 8 meses
Puntos: 9
Respuesta: JSP mensajes de alerta

sii tenes razón los JOptioPane solo son para aplicaciones de escritorio

para las aplicaciones web se utiliza los alert

te voy a dejar un ejemplo

Código PHP:
      <%
            
int a 8;
            if(
a>10){
                %>
                <
script>alert("siii");</script>
                <%
            }else{
                %>
                <script>alert("nooo");</script>
                <%
            }
        %> 
es solo un ejemplo muy sencillo espero que te sirva...
  #3 (permalink)  
Antiguo 22/09/2010, 08:46
Avatar de cesarazapata  
Fecha de Ingreso: mayo-2010
Ubicación: Bogota
Mensajes: 12
Antigüedad: 13 años, 11 meses
Puntos: 0
Respuesta: JSP mensajes de alerta

Gracias por tu respuesta, en el jsp se puede hacer esto, el unico inconveninte que veom, es que quiero generar este tipo de alertas en un servlet, y ahi no se como hacerlo
  #4 (permalink)  
Antiguo 22/09/2010, 10:43
 
Fecha de Ingreso: enero-2008
Mensajes: 197
Antigüedad: 16 años, 3 meses
Puntos: 10
Respuesta: JSP mensajes de alerta

Cita:
Iniciado por cesarazapata Ver Mensaje
Gracias por tu respuesta, en el jsp se puede hacer esto, el unico inconveninte que veom, es que quiero generar este tipo de alertas en un servlet, y ahi no se como hacerlo
mmmm creo que estás un poco confundido, un servlet "corre" del lado del servidor, es posible que tu puedas generar el código html ponerlo en el response y sacarlo desde ahí pero sería absolutamente terrible porque estarías mezclando las capas de tu aplicación (modelo, vista), también tu código se vuelve difícil de mantener y extender.

Te recomiendo separar la lógica de tu aplicación en tu modelo y la parte de la vista (tus ventanas, input del usuario etc) en los jsps.


Saludos!
  #5 (permalink)  
Antiguo 22/09/2010, 13:14
Avatar de cesarazapata  
Fecha de Ingreso: mayo-2010
Ubicación: Bogota
Mensajes: 12
Antigüedad: 13 años, 11 meses
Puntos: 0
Respuesta: JSP mensajes de alerta

Cita:
Iniciado por hualro Ver Mensaje
mmmm creo que estás un poco confundido, un servlet "corre" del lado del servidor, es posible que tu puedas generar el código html ponerlo en el response y sacarlo desde ahí pero sería absolutamente terrible porque estarías mezclando las capas de tu aplicación (modelo, vista), también tu código se vuelve difícil de mantener y extender.

Te recomiendo separar la lógica de tu aplicación en tu modelo y la parte de la vista (tus ventanas, input del usuario etc) en los jsps.


Saludos!
si tenes toda la razón, lo que sucedía es que estaba generando la aplicación y los mensajes de alerta los genere con el joptionpane desde el servlet, pero ahora cai en cuenta que esta mezclando la capa de presentación con la capa lógica del negocio,ahora me toco sacar los mensajes del servlet y mostrar un html de error, de todos modos muchas gracias por sus coetearios y aclaraciones

Etiquetas: jsp, mensajes, alerta
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:30.